DeepWall is the leading AI-powered deepfake detection platform, offering real-time monitoring to safeguard digital identities. Designed for executives, public figures, and enterprises, our advanced technology instantly identifies deepfakes across major social media platforms. Protect your online security and reputation with continuous surveillance, facial recognition, and voice biometrics. DeepWall provides immediate alerts and comprehensive evidence packages, ensuring swift action against impersonation and misinformation.
